Notes

  1. "Bunraku" a type of traditional Japanese puppet theater. "Maiden's Bunraku" is a style of performance where a Bunraku puppet, normally controlled by up to three people, is controlled by only one girl.
  2. 輪廻: Samsara, a Buddhist term meaning "metempsychosis", "reincarnation", or "endless cycle of rebirth".
  3. means "traditional Japanese elegance".
  4. "Curse" (咒詛) is written here in Chinese; the Japanese equivalent is 呪詛. Shanghai is a city in China.
  5. Hourai is a legendary island paradise in folklore, which was said to be inhabited by immortals who had special powers, and possessed rare treasures as well as the elixir of immortality.
